It was a panel show and it started with Kevin Corrigan talking with Amy for a good 15 minutes. After that, they brought on Anthony. His entrance went something like this:

Kevin Corrigan: And our next guest, Anthony Cumia!

applause

Anthony: quasi-yelling SO HERE'S WHAT HAPPENED IN TIMES SQUARE. I WAS OUT TAKING PICTURES AND-...

The whole crowd was in stunned silence. The 50% of the room that was there for Amy had no idea what was going on. The other 50% of us - there for Anthony - quickly realized that Anthony was way too drunk for this thing.

So, the whole conversation steers towards Anthony, the events of that night, and his firing from SiriusXM. As Anthony defends himself, the Amy side of the crowd boos him hard. Amy actually intervenes for Anthony and says "I don't agree with what Anthony did, but he is my friend and I love him."

This doesn't stop the Amy crowd and it immediately raised visible tension between Anthony and Amy. Anthony seems surprised that Amy isn't saying that he shouldn't have been fired from Sirius. Amy is embarrassed that Anthony put her in this situation where she had to defend him at all with his fans.

Taran Killam (then of SNL) is then brought on and he has a full-blown debate with Anthony over the events, although Killam didn't seem to know any more about the story than the Schumer fans in the room. As they go blow-for-blow in this argument, the Amy fans cheer for everything that Killam says and the Anthony fans responded in kind for Anthony's points.

The whole thing wound up being far more tense than Kevin, Amy, or any of the people associated with the show could have predicted.
